New India Assurance Company Ltd vs Nusli Neville Wadia And Another

The Supreme Court addressed the procedural question of who should lead evidence in eviction proceedings under the Public Premises (Eviction of Unauthorised Occupants) Act, 1971. The Court held that the burden of proof lies on the party seeking eviction, thereby establishing that the appellant, New India Assurance Company Ltd., must present its evidence first. The judgment reversed the Bombay High Court's decision that had favored the tenant's request to lead evidence first, thereby upholding the Estate Officer's order.
